Nana didn't live in Seadonna Tower. Instead she lived in a small townhouse on the outskirts of the city. Ashley drove us to the location as she talked to me to prepare me for my first meeting with who everyone considers their grandmother. I was feeling a little nervous because I was pretty much picturing a walking skeleton at this point. Ashley really wasn't telling me what Nana looked like other than that she could pass as anyone's grandmother.
"Why does she live so far from Sedonna Tower?" I asked her as we came to a stop in front of a row of townhouses. I wasn't even sure which one was the one that Nana lived in.
"It's neutral ground between the two families," she answered, "Her wishes because she wasn't going to turn any of the family's children away when they needed guidance."
Even if I understood the reasoning, it still terrified me that we might run into someone from the Shidonna family. There really was no telling how much respect they had for the old woman inside the townhouse. From what I experienced, they would probably start a fight and hurt someone with any chance they had.
Ashley and I climbed out of her car and headed up the front steps towards the house. The front door opened and someone with red eyes exited the building. They didn't even pay attention to us as they walked past us and then down the street. I couldn't help but look after them in confusion.
"Leah, are you coming?" I heard Ashley ask. I didn't realize that I had stopped and she continued to catch the door before it closed. Quickly I ran up the rest of the stairs and entered the building with her.
The place was dark inside. All of the curtains were closed and a faint smell of incense filled the air. As we walked into the living room on the left, a woman dressed as a nurse walked up to us and greeted us. Her mouth was covered by a medical mask, but I could tell by the crinkling of her eyes that she was smiling.

"Welcome Leah. We've been expecting you," the nurse greeted and then motioned with her head to have us follow her further into the house.
We walked through the living room and through an archway into a small dated kitchen. The nurse then continued to lead us outside the back door onto a small patio. The patio was surrounded by different types of flowers, but I was drawn to the rose bush. It sat next to a rocking chair where an old woman sat.
Ashley stood in front of the woman with a kind smile and announced our arrival, "Hello Nana. Leah and I came to visit you."
"Hello Dear. Tell Leah that it is okay to come admire the rose bush. I had it put there so I can get a good look at her," the old woman said. This whole trip was taking me by surprise.
The old woman in front of me wasn't what I had imagined. I was expecting someone that was so old that she was almost a skeleton. But the more I looked at this old woman the more she looked like she was just well into her eighties. She looked healthy and alert. The only thing wrong that I could notice that was wrong with her was the milkiness of her eyes. Nana was clearly blind.
Slowly, I shuffled up to her. Unsure of what was going to happen, but my eyes refused to leave the sight of the old woman. Even if I really did want to admire the rose bush next to her. There was just something about the old woman that made me nervous and not knowing what that was, scared me.
"Everyone can leave us alone. Leah will come find you Ashley when I am done talking to her," Nana ordered. No one asked any questions as they followed what was instructed. Leaving me alone with her on the back patio. Unsure what to do, I just stood there like an idiot, "You can pull up one of the other chairs so you can sit next to me. I won't bite."

Thinking it was best to not argue with her, I grabbed the closest chair and placed in next to her. Keeping the rose bush between us. For some reason I saw it as a barrier that could protect me.
Nana let out a sigh as she stared out in front of her. I was pretty sure she wasn't going to say anything but then I remembered that she wanted to talk to me, "I would like to first apologize for how my family seems to take things," she began, "They took what I said out of context. Putting a lot of pressure on you."
"What are you talking about?" I heard myself ask.
"I never said that you would end the war. I only said that you could by saving Donny from himself," she explained, "But you can't mess with free will even if those dang kids think you can. There is no guarantee that Donny will change and there is no telling if one of his followers will take his place when he falls."
"So I'm not supposed to save the whole family from this war?" I said a little surprised and still a little relieved.
She shook her head, "You are only supposed to save Donny from himself. Bring the brothers back together. Make them understand each other." she paused only long enough to have her milky gray eyes look at me directly. Chilling me to the bone, "Donny grew up being prepared to become a king while Ricky was given the freedom he wasn't allowed. Jealousy took over and made his heart dark, making him lose everything. Only you can make Donny see things differently."
"How am I supposed to do that?" I asked her.
Nana responded, "Donny isn't completely heartless. He just feels like no one has ever cared about him other than the family he has created. His jealousy has him blinded to the love his brother has for him. Make him see and he just might be able to change."
"I have one more question," I mentioned to her.
She returned to look straight ahead as she answered, "You are looking for guidance with the soulmate situation. I know he is a lot to handle and tends to hover. David lost the one person who he loved to the enemy, he is just scared that it will happen again."
"What about Derik?" I heard myself ask Nana.
She suddenly got a serious tone as she answered, "What you choose to do is up to you. No one can make those choices for you. But you should know that things may have changed after that incident back in your hometown. Just be cautious on who you trust, it could be your downfall."
